Frequently Asked Questions about Waseca

How much are Studio apartments in Waseca?

There are currently 12 Studio Apartments in Waseca with rent ranges from $1,000 to $1,315 with an average price of $1,153.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Waseca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Waseca ranges from $665 to $1,725 with an average monthly rent of $1,263.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Waseca c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Waseca range from $875 to $2,830.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,490.

How expensive are Waseca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 26 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Waseca on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$925 to $2,100 - averaging $1,594 for the location.
